Transaction 3b70e491b2765c17a190c24de544d720e6c5ff51f82021ad1684d38fece720b1

1 Input
2 Outputs
  • 3b70e491b2765c17a190c24de544d720e6c5ff51f82021ad1684d38fece720b1:0
  • value  3081558
    address  3AHHx1e3GSCZ4xpucYwy2H3Umdf84SnWRN
  • 3b70e491b2765c17a190c24de544d720e6c5ff51f82021ad1684d38fece720b1:1
  • value  19805
    address  3HVXCitBpjPALfNP66qyB2AoQfWqJ9Jjwj